In centuries-old tradition, sheep, goats travel Madrid streets

Oct 25, 2022

MADRID, Spain: In keeping with traditions, 1,400 sheep and goats took over downtown Madrid on the weekend, as part of a festival to move livestock to their winter grazing grounds.

In a centuries-old reenactment, shepherds herded the animals through the streets of Madrid, as livestock were transferred to lowland winter pastures.

Madrid encompasses part of the 78,000-mile grid of farming paths that cover the Iberian Peninsula.

In Madrid, residents lined the streets to watch the annual ritual, as children reached out to touch the wool of the sheep.

Similar festivals are held in France and California.
